Deciding between Munich and Vienna for your next remote-work base? On the overall Nomad Score, Munich and Vienna are neck and neck at 8.5. On budget, Vienna is the more affordable of the two at roughly $3,200 a month versus $3,800 in Munich. Below is the full side-by-side across all 13 factors we rate, plus where each city pulls ahead.

The verdict

Choose Munich for nature, nightlife, community. Choose Vienna for culture, cleanliness, food and a lower monthly budget. For an interactive breakdown with a third city, open the full comparison tool.

Frequently asked questions

Is Munich or Vienna cheaper for digital nomads?

Vienna is the cheaper base, around $3,200 a month versus $3,800 in Munich, a difference of about $600.

Which has better WiFi, Munich or Vienna?

Both score 8/10 for WiFi, so connectivity is comparable.

Which is safer, Munich or Vienna?

Both rate 9/10 on safety.

Munich or Vienna: which is better overall for remote work?

They tie on the overall Nomad Score (8.5/10), so it comes down to your priorities.
